Title : 
Compensated broadband five-section directional coupler for application in butler matrices

            Abstract : 
A broadband five-section symmetrical 3 dB directional coupler has been designed. In order to improve the frequency characteristic of the coupler a recently proposed compensation technique has been used. The developed coupler operates in 2–12 GHz frequency band and can be applied in a broadband 4×4 Butler matrix.
